REVISOR'S NOTE: This section is new language derived; without substantive
change from former Art. 73B, §§ 2-303, 2-304, 3-303, and 3-304.

In subsection (a) of this section, the phrase "for which the member is not
otherwise entitled to service credit" is added to clarify that a member may not
receive duplicate service credit for the same period of employment.

In subsection (b)(1)(i) of this section, the reference to "complet[ing] a claim
for service credit and fil[ing] it with the Board of Trustees on a form that the
Board of Trustees provides" is added to state expressly that which formerly
only was implied — i.e., that a completed claim must be filed for the service
credit.

In subsection (b)(1)(ii) of this section, the reference to payment to "the Board
of Trustees" is added to clarify to whom the payment is to be made.

In subsection (c)(1)(xi) of this section, the references to employment by "a
standing committee or delegation of the Senate or House of Delegates", "the
office of the assistant to the President of the Senate and Speaker of the House
of Delegates", and "any division under the jurisdiction of the President of the
Senate and Speaker of the House of Delegates within those offices" are
deleted as included in the comprehensive reference to employment by "a
member of the Senate or House of Delegates".
